目的 观察雪旺细胞源神经营养因子在大鼠生长发育腰髓中的表达。方法 取不同年龄的胎鼠、幼鼠及成年鼠的腰髓或相关组织 ,行常规免疫组织化学研究。结果 雪旺细胞源神经营养因子在成年大鼠腰髓的整个白质和灰质后角Ⅲ、Ⅳ、Ⅴ层有较低表达。雪旺细胞源神经营养因子在胎龄 1 4、1 5d开始有表达 ,胚胎时期表达先增高后下降 ,其中胎龄 2 1d最高。出生后雪旺细胞源神经营养因子 (SDNF)在腰髓中表达明显下降 ,其中第 7、1 2d稍高。结论 SDNF在成年大鼠腰髓 (包括背根神经节 )有较低表达。SDNF在生长发育的腰髓中表达基本呈逐渐下降趋势。SDNF对大鼠脊髓的发育可能起促进作用
Objective To observe the expression of Schwann cell-derived neurotrophic factor (BDNF) in the rat lumbar spinal cord. Methods The lumbar spinal cord or related tissues of fetal rats, young rats and adult mice of different ages were taken for routine immunohistochemistry. Results Schwann cell-derived neurotrophic factor (BDNF) was found to be low expressed in the layers III, IV and Ⅴ of the whole white matter and gray matter posterior horn of adult rat lumbar spinal cord. Schwann cell derived neurotrophic factor expression in gestational age 1 4,1 5d, the expression of embryonic first increased and then decreased, of which the highest gestational age 21d. After birth, Schwann cell source neurotrophic factor (SDNF) was significantly decreased in the lumbar spinal cord, of which the 7th and 12th days were slightly higher. Conclusion SDNF is lower expressed in the lumbar spinal cord (including dorsal root ganglion) in adult rats. The expression of SDNF in the development of the lumbar spinal cord showed a gradual downward trend. SDNF may promote the development of spinal cord in rats
